Understanding HIV and HPV
HIV is a virus that attacks the body’s immune system, specifically the CD4 cells (T-lymphocytes). Once inside the human body, HIV replicates itself, creating more viruses and gradually weakening the immune system.
Without proper treatment and care, HIV can progress to AIDS, which is the final stage of the infection. HIV is primarily transmitted through sexual contact, sharing needles, pregnancy, childbirth, and breastfeeding. On the other hand, HPV is a common virus that infects the skin and mucous membranes.
There are over 100 different types of HPV, some of which can cause warts, while others may lead to cancer. HPV is primarily transmitted through sexual contact, including vaginal, anal, and oral sex.
Most people who contract HPV do not develop any symptoms or health problems, but some strains can cause genital warts or various types of cancer.
HPV-Related Cancers
HPV is strongly associated with several types of cancer, including cervical, anal, vaginal, vulvar, penile, and oropharyngeal cancer. It is estimated that HPV is responsible for over 90% of cervical and anal cancers. Most HPV infections clear up on their own without causing any long-term complications.
However, in some cases, the virus can persist and lead to the development of abnormal cells, which may eventually become cancerous.
Impact of HIV on HPV-Related Cancers
HIV weakens the immune system, making individuals more susceptible to various infections and diseases. When someone with HIV is infected with HPV, their weakened immune system may struggle to fight off the virus efficiently.
This increases the likelihood of persistent HPV infection and the development of HPV-related cancers. Individuals with HIV are at a significantly higher risk of developing cervical, anal, and other HPV-related cancers compared to those without HIV.
Collaboration between HIV and HPV
The collaboration between HIV and HPV involves several factors:.
1. Immune Suppression
HIV weakens the immune system by specifically attacking CD4 cells, which play a crucial role in regulating immune responses. By suppressing the immune system, HIV creates an environment that allows HPV to thrive and persist.
HPV-infected cells can go unnoticed and continue to replicate, leading to the development of cancerous cells.
2. Increased HPV Viral Load
Studies have shown that HIV-positive individuals tend to have a higher HPV viral load compared to those without HIV.
A higher viral load means there are more HPV particles present in the body, increasing the chances of infection and potential cancerous growth.
3. HPV Integration
HPV can integrate its viral DNA into the host’s DNA, potentially causing genomic instability and promoting cancer development. HIV, by its nature, can enhance the integration of HPV into the host genome.
This integration increases the risk of cancerous transformation of the infected cells.
4. Co-infections and Synergistic Effects
People with HIV often have other sexually transmitted infections (STIs) concurrently. These co-infections can further weaken the immune system and contribute to the progression of HPV-related cancers.
Additionally, the presence of both HIV and HPV can lead to synergistic effects, where the combined action of these viruses further enhances the risk of cancer development.
Prevention and Screening
Preventive measures and regular screenings play a vital role in reducing the risk of HIV and HPV-related cancers. This includes:.
1. Safe Sexual Practices
Using condoms or dental dams can significantly reduce the risk of transmitting both HIV and HPV during sexual activity. Additionally, limiting the number of sexual partners and avoiding high-risk behaviors can help prevent infections.
2. HPV Vaccination
Vaccination against HPV is recommended for both males and females. The HPV vaccine can help protect against several high-risk HPV strains that are responsible for most HPV-related cancers.
Vaccination is most effective when administered before the individual becomes sexually active.
3. Regular Screenings
Regular screenings, such as Pap tests, are essential for detecting any abnormal changes in cervical cells. HPV testing may also be recommended, especially for individuals with HIV.
Early detection can lead to timely interventions and improved treatment outcomes.
